What You'll Be Doing

As a Senior Application Security Engineer, you'll lead the application security practice within the Loyalty division security team, taking responsibility for key security KPIs in this area.

You'll champion secure software development by working closely with engineers, architects and product teams, embedding security practices into our engineering culture. You'll provide training, offer expert advice, and drive awareness of security from the earliest stages of design through to deployment.

You'll help integrate automated security tooling and checks into our CI/CD pipelines, facilitate threat modelling sessions, and review security‑sensitive design decisions around authentication, cryptography, API security, data protection and logging. You'll also ensure that tools such as SAST, DAST and SCA are effective and efficient, and that testing programmes — including penetration testing, vulnerability scanning and bug bounty initiatives — are delivering value.

As our adoption of AI accelerates, you'll partner with engineering and platform teams to identify and address emerging security risks associated with AI‑powered products, large language models and Agentic AI architectures. You'll help establish security guardrails, patterns and best practices that enable teams to innovate confidently while maintaining appropriate controls around data, access, model usage, agent orchestration and third‑party integrations.

You'll play a key role in helping the business safely leverage AI to automate and optimise complex workflows, enhance customer experiences and unlock new growth opportunities, ensuring security is embedded from experimentation through to production scale.

You'll triage vulnerabilities, support engineering teams with practical mitigations, contribute to documentation that strengthens our internal standards and processes, and help shape the future of secure AI adoption across the organisation. What We Need From You

* Experience in software engineering, with a strong security mindset.
* Deep understanding of web, application and API vulnerabilities, including the OWASP Top 10.
* Proficient in coding, scripting (e.g. Python, Bash) and automating security controls within CI/CD pipelines.
* Hands‑on experience with security tools such as SAST, DAST and SCA.
* Familiar with cloud‑native environments (especially AWS), containers, Kubernetes and microservices architectures.
* Comfortable reviewing technical designs, performing threat modelling and advising on secure architecture patterns.
* Strong understanding of emerging AI security considerations, including large language models, AI‑enabled applications and Agentic AI architectures, with a passion for helping shape and secure our adoption journey in this space.
* Strong communicator who collaborates effectively with engineers and promotes secure‑by‑default and secure‑by‑design practices.
